#d5499d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d5499d is composed of 83.5% red, 28.6% green and 61.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 65.7% magenta, 26.3% yellow and 16.5% black. It has a hue angle of 324 degrees, a saturation of 62.5% and a lightness of 56.1%. #d5499d color hex could be obtained by blending #ff92ff with #ab003b. Closest websafe color is: #cc3399.

Shades and Tints of #d5499d

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#090206 is the darkest color, while #fdf8f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#d5499d

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#908e8f is the less saturated color, while #f727a4 is the most saturated one.
